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
157 70907 294 6606 7057592
4051565 3217 7437887990
4051565 3217 7437887990
25 138828 07641687
All about undefined
Interested in learning more?
4051565 3217 7437887990
25 138828 07641687
See more
369283992 768 503318
10142 458500 305108697 2391
See more
1532567509 4447920929 3807
928755541 5825 033631 807320
See more